Diana Tennant
Female
Leeds
PHYSICIAN, SUGEON, REGISTERED PRACTITIONER, INCLUDING POOR LAW HOSPITALS DOCTORS ETC
21 / Feb / 1904
Leeds, Yorkshire, England
14 / May / 1986
Spofforth, Yorkshire, England
Expand all